## Further reading

If you're digging into Gridwick's fill algorithm, start with the comments in `filler.py` — they're dense but honest. The word-scoring heuristics came from a long internal debate that never fully resolved, so don't assume the current weights are sacred. Clue generation is a separate beast entirely and lives in its own module. For the history of why we abandoned backtracking-only fill, plus benchmarks and rejected approaches, see the write-up linked below.

dashboard of tawef-hagug = https://superset.norvadyn.local/display/projects/build/ticket/build/spaces/ticket/1e989f0e6c200d20fc4ae06b

## 4.12.0 — Changed defaults

Query planner regression in Lanternfish 4.11.x: nested-loop joins were preferred over hash joins on mid-size tables after stats refresh, causing 10–40x latency spikes on the reporting path. Root cause: cost constant changes shipped in 4.11.0. Fix: reverted planner cost defaults and pinned join strategy hints on the two worst queries. If paged for slow reports, confirm the node runs 4.12.0 before anything else. The planner settings now shipped as defaults are listed below.

config for tawif-bagef:
[sorwyn]
team = sorys
access_code = ac_9ba40c
host = sorwyn.ordingrid.local
port = 5000
owner = aldok.quenion
peer = belath.paliqcloud.local

### Contrast Audit Quickstart — Pixelgrove

Hey, welcome aboard! The contrast sweep runs against every screen in the Lanternview design system and flags anything under AA thresholds. Kick it off with `pgaudit scan --theme all` and dump results to the shared report bucket. One gotcha: the scanner needs auth to pull rendered screenshots from the preview service. Open `.env.audit` in the repo root and put the token line right after this comment.

sealed setting: VAULT_KEY3=eec